Analysis of Nas.io

Overall verdict

  • Nas.io is a solid all-in-one community management platform that helps creators and educators launch, manage, and monetize their communities with minimal technical setup, making it a good choice for those looking to build engaged audiences and recurring revenue.

Why this product is good

  • Offers an all-in-one toolkit for building and managing online communities, including memberships, events, and content
  • Simplifies monetization through subscriptions, paid events, challenges, and digital products
  • Integrates well with popular platforms like WhatsApp, Telegram, and Discord for seamless community engagement
  • User-friendly interface that requires little to no technical expertise to get started
  • Provides analytics and tools to track member engagement and growth
  • Backed by strong funding and a growing global creator ecosystem

Recommended for

  • Content creators and influencers looking to monetize their audience
  • Educators and coaches running online courses or cohort-based programs
  • Community builders managing groups on WhatsApp, Telegram, or Discord
  • Small businesses and entrepreneurs wanting to create recurring membership revenue
  • Event organizers hosting paid workshops, challenges, or webinars
